Well, there's your problem! The term "specific activity" is defined as the amount
of radioactivity - or the decay rate - of a particular
radionuclide per unit mass of the radionuclide. For
example, the specific activity of Ra-226 is 1, meaning
that one gram of Ra-226 contains one (1) curie (assumed
to be uniformly distributed throughout that mass)
